Transaction 50f63fcf386a22061f24233cf77eae17961da4e533c113c95cf29f77a56580f8
1 Input
1 Output
-
50f63fcf386a22061f24233cf77eae17961da4e533c113c95cf29f77a56580f8:0
- value
- 13602487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91b10bcfb4b4cdf90b06a4f219b8d7e05cf5ecf2 OP_EQUAL
- address
- 3EyMzjuHUxYkoBTy7dUNgGDY8cfhPYJvvv